JENKS, Oklahoma -- Jenks continued its tradition of turning out multiple football signees on National Signing Day. The Trojans had five players sign letters of intent to Division I schools and six football signees overall.
Jarrett Lake created a bit of a surprise for some by committing to Arkansas after verbally committing to Oklahoma last year.
Jake Alexander followed in the footsteps of his father, former NFL star David Alexander, and signed with Tulsa.
Fellow lineman Bob Graham and David Lore also signed with Division I teams. Graham is headed to Iowa State, while Lore inked with Air Force.
Tyler Ott is headed to the Ivy League where he will play for the Harvard Crimson.
Also moving onto the next level is Chris King, who will play at Central Oklahoma.
2010 Jenks Signees
Jarrett Lake - Arkansas
Jake Alexander - Tulsa
Bob Graham - Iowa State
David Lore - Air Force
Tyler Ott - Harvard
Chris King - Central Oklahoma
